NEWS: Tesla plans to warn the Senate Commerce Committee tomorrow that China will be the dominant manufacturer of transportation for the 21st century if the United States does not modernize regulations for self-driving cars, according to written testimony. Tesla will appear before the committee to make its case for updated regulatory frameworks that could accelerate the development and deployment of self-driving technology.

The Tesla Cybercab is coming for Waymo’s breakfast, lunch, and dinner. And when it arrives at scale, the meaning of transportation as we know it today will change forever. The Tesla Cybercab is a purpose built robotaxi, designed from the ground up from day one for one job only - moving people autonomously, as safe as possible, and in the most cost efficient way. And FYI, there will be NO steering wheel and NO pedals. I’m willing to bet anyone any $ amount if they think otherwise. The Cybercab will be a: • Two passenger design optimized for ride hailing • Vision only autonomy with cameras and neural nets, no lidar or radar • Unsupervised FSD built to operate without a human driver •~300 miles of range, enough for nonstop daily use • Aiming to cost under $30,000 A vehicle this affordable, running 24/7 with no driver cost will change the math completely. Ride prices will drop significantly, utilization will go up, margins will expand, and adoption will accelerate. And for people that think this is NEVER happening: • Prototypes are already being tested on real streets in Austin and the Bay Area • Production ramp is beginning in April 2026 (just 3 month away) at Giga Texas, w/ initial fleets targeting 200-300K, aiming to produce 2M Cybercabs per yr YES, this product is happening. And I think Tesla knows a thing or two on how to scale manufacturing better than any company in the world… 🤣 This is why Waymo is going to be in trouble, despite Waymo deserving credit for proving autonomy works in small, controlled, geofenced areas. But at the same time that’s also their main limitation. Waymo vehicles: • Cost well over $100k+ each • Rely on lidar, radar, and a super heavy sensor stacks • Require city-by-city HD mapping • Scale very slowly, fleet size is only ~2,500 While Tesla vehicles: • ~9M of cars are already collecting millions of real world data on the daily • Software improves across the entire fleet instantly • Vehicles are affordable enough and Tesla has the manufacturing technology to deploy at massive scale • Will have no geofencing limitations long term This is why people comparing ride counts today between these two companies are missing the point. I’m expecting Tesla to surpass Waymo’s fleet size and revenue before the end of 2026! Once Cybercabs are flooding the streets, I believe you’ll begin to see: 1/ Ride costs drop dramatically, potentially 20-30% or more of today’s prices 2/ Hailing a ride will be available 24/7, no downtime, no human drivers 3/ Massive safety gains bc AI autonomy doesn’t text, drink, or get tired 4/ Less car ownership, so cities will change, parking lots will be less, space will open up 5/ Transportation will become access based, instead of ownership based THIS is why I’m so convicted about the next chapter of Tesla. And once this clicks for people, and you experience just one ride, the definition of transportation will never be the same.

$TSLA is the biggest bubble in stock market history with a market cap of $1.6T. Never before has a single stock been so overpriced at such a scale. $TSLA auto sales are in free fall and will decline double digits in 2026. Next year will be the third consecutive year of declining unit sales. There will be no robotaxis for many years as approval takes years and $TSLA has not even filed the necessary applications. $TSLA just admitted to the California DMV, “The currently enabled Autopilot and Full Self-Driving features require active driver supervision and do not make the vehicle autonomous.” They will sell zero robots in 2026. The competition is way ahead. The share price is sustained only by the lies of @elonmusk Earnings estimates continue to collapse. Estimates for 2025 have gone from $8 to 1.65 yet the share price has more than doubled from the April 2025 lows. I expect the share price to ultimately converge with the decline in profits. Pent up selling (for tax purposes), the failure to launch paid robotaxis and the announcement of horrendous 4q deliveries may well cause the stock to crater early in the new year. Fair value is perhaps $50. The emperor is wearing no clothes.
